FATAL CYCLE ACCIDENT.
CAUSED BY A DOG. Hawera, Stptember 20. Mr \V. D. Taylor, traveller for Mr W. F. Short, monumental mason, of New Plymouth, was riding a 'pushbike near Ka;upokonui,' yesterday, when a dog ran out on the road, upsetting him. Taylor, who was badly injured, was taken to the Manaia private hospital, where he died early this morning'.
